#A648EE Hex Color Code

#A648EE

The Hexadecimal Color #A648EE is a contrast shade of Medium Orchid. #A648EE RGB value is rgb(166, 72, 238). RGB Color Model of #A648EE consists of 65% red, 28% green and 93% blue. HSL color Mode of #A648EE has 274°(degrees) Hue, 83% Saturation and 61% Lightness. #A648EE color has an wavelength of 447.48148n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A648EE is #CC66F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A648EE is #A4E. The Closest Color to #A648EE is #BA55D3. Official Name of #A648EE Hex Code is Amethyst.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A648EE is 30 Cyan 70 Magenta 0 Yellow 7 Black and #A648EE CMY is 30, 70,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#A648EE is hsl(274,83,61,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(274, 70, 93).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#A648EE is 33.47, 18.92, 82.76.
Hex8 Value of #A648EE is #A648EEFF. Decimal Value of #A648EE is 10897646 and Octal Value of #A648EE is 51444356. Binary Value of #A648EE is 10100110, 1001000, 11101110 and Android of #A648EE is 4289087726 / 0xffa648ee.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#A648EE is 0.248, 0.14, 0.14 and YIQ Color Space of #A648EE is 119.03, 2.6788, 71.5402.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#A648EE is 19.21, 9.07, 81.74.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#A648EE is 50.59, 66.04, -67.71.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#A648EE is 50.59, 25.58, -110.01.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#A648EE is 50.59, 94.58, 314.28. Hunter Lab variable of #A648EE is 43.5, 61.23, -82.36.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A648EE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
